Crafted Landscapes

The Concept

Crafted Landscapes is a project developed for the group exhibition STARDUST | Fotografia e mitologia western. The exhibition, curated by Francesco Zanot and Luca Andreoni features work by the 2018-2019 students of the Master in Photography and Visual Design (NABA Milano). It runs from the 28th September until the 30th October 2019 at MUFOCO, via Frova 10, Cinisello Balsamo - MI.

As students, we were tasked to interpret the 'Western Movie' theme and create an artist book. Being a designer by profession, I decided to merge the world of graphic design with photography and analyse themes commonly found in western movies using shapes that form the bedrock of any design. 

By adopting this deconstructivist approach, I could take an abstract and analytical approach, This allowed me to distinguish my work and also understand better the syntagmatic and paradigmatic elements that form the basis of the Western Movie. The work, presented as a puzzle, leaves it up to the readers to conduct their own constitutive analysis. More than providing a definitive answer, Crafted Landscapes aims to be a starting point for further visual inquiries into the Western movie genre.

Book Production

The inside pages were digitally printed on fine art paper at Studio GM. Once the inside pages were printed, I turned to Daniela Lorenzi of A14 - Stampa Originale d' Arte to help me with the book's cover and binding. Her experience with artists proved invaluable in helping me identify which cover and bookbinding techniques worked best to communicate what Crafted Landscapes is about.
